Foundation - Button Group Coloring



Description

Each button in the button group can be colored individually or every button can be colored by using the same class.

Example

The following example demonstrates how to color button group in Foundation.

<html>
   <head>
      <title>Button Group Coloring</title>
      <link rel="stylesheet" href="https://cdn.jsdelivr.net/npm/foundation-sites@6.5.1/dist/css/foundation.min.css" integrity="sha256-1mcRjtAxlSjp6XJBgrBeeCORfBp/ppyX4tsvpQVCcpA= sha384-b5S5X654rX3Wo6z5/hnQ4GBmKuIJKMPwrJXn52ypjztlnDK2w9+9hSMBz/asy9Gw sha512-M1VveR2JGzpgWHb0elGqPTltHK3xbvu3Brgjfg4cg5ZNtyyApxw/45yHYsZ/rCVbfoO5MSZxB241wWq642jLtA==" crossorigin="anonymous">

   </head>

   <body>
      <div class = "button-group">
         <a class = "secondary button">Secondary</a>
         <a class = "success button">Success</a>
         <a class = "warning button">Warning</a>
         <a class = "alert button">Alert</a>
      </div>

      <div class = "success button-group">
         <a class = "button">Button</a>
         <a class = "button">With</a>
         <a class = "button">Success</a>
         <a class = "button">Class</a>
      </div>

      <script src = "https://cdnjs.cloudflare.com/ajax/libs/foundation/6.0.1/js/vendor/jquery.min.js"></script>
      <script src = "https://cdnjs.cloudflare.com/ajax/libs/foundation/6.0.1/js/foundation.min.js"></script>

      <script>
         $(document).ready(function() {
            $(document).foundation();
         })
      </script>
   </body>
</html>
